Unknown persons steal rifle from SOG man’s residential quarter in Tral

SOG man suspended, 8 persons arrested

5 Dariya News

Srinagar 12-Aug-2014

Some unknown persons have stolen a service rifle of a Special Operation Group (SOG) man from his family quarter at Tral area in south Kashmir’s Pulwama district last evening.Official sources told GNS that policeman Latif Ahmad Gojri who is working with SOG Tral reported his senior officers that his rifle AK-47 along with a pouch and few magazines had gone missing from his residence. “The family quarter of the policeman is just 100 meters far away from SOG camp in the area”.They said that the SOG man who was appointed as SPO in 2000 and was recently converted into follower in the department was immediately placed under suspension.

A senior police official while confirmed the incident to GNS on Tuesday said that the policeman was detained for questioning, besides it, police team arrested at least eight suspected persons from different localities in the area.“A case has been registered in this regard and the departmental inquiry has also been initiated. The facts of the incident would be revealed during the course of investigations,” the official said.On July 21, a service rifle of a policeman Fayaz Ahmad of 71 IR 2nd battalion who was posted at a shrine in Awantipora had gone missing.On August 1, Militants after barged inside the police post guarding the house of a sessions judge Sujat Ali Khan at Qamarabad in Qamarwari area of Srinagar city and decamped with an AK-47 rifle along with 02 magazines and 20 rounds.Meanwhile, a senior Home Ministry official told GNS that authorities beefed up the security in all major volatile parts of the Kashmir Valley following the recent rifle snatching incidents and sudden spurt in militant related activities across Valley.
